Application and Maintenance Tips
Achieving optimal results when using a finishing oil requires careful preparation and application. The following tips aim to provide a comprehensive guide for both novice and experienced users.
Tip 1: Surface Preparation is Paramount. Ensure the wood surface is clean, dry, and free from any existing finishes, waxes, or contaminants. Sanding to a smooth finish is recommended for optimal penetration and adhesion of the product.
Tip 2: Apply Thin Coats. Avoid applying the oil in thick layers. Multiple thin coats, allowing sufficient drying time between each, will produce a more even and durable finish.
Tip 3: Proper Drying Time is Critical. Adhere strictly to the manufacturer’s recommended drying times. Insufficient drying can lead to a tacky or uneven finish.
Tip 4: Buffing Enhances the Sheen. After the final coat has dried, buffing the surface with a clean, lint-free cloth will enhance the sheen and provide a smoother, more refined finish.
Tip 5: Regular Maintenance Prolongs Life. Periodic re-application of a thin coat of finishing oil can help to maintain the wood’s protection and appearance, especially in high-traffic areas.
Tip 6: Address Scratches Promptly. Minor scratches can often be repaired by lightly sanding the affected area and applying a small amount of finishing oil.
Tip 7: Consider Environmental Factors. Temperature and humidity can affect drying times. Ensure adequate ventilation during application and drying.

1. Penetration
Penetration is a critical attribute influencing the effectiveness of the finishing oil. The oil’s ability to permeate the wood’s cellular structure directly impacts its protective and aesthetic qualities. Without adequate penetration, the oil remains on the surface, offering minimal protection against moisture, scratches, and UV damage. The depth of penetration determines the degree to which the wood is nourished and stabilized, preventing warping, cracking, and other forms of degradation.
The formulation of the oil directly affects its penetration capabilities. A lower viscosity allows for easier absorption into the wood’s pores. For example, applying finishing oil to a coarsely grained wood like oak demonstrates the importance of penetration. The oil fills the open pores, enhancing the grain’s appearance and providing a robust barrier. Conversely, if a finish with poor penetration is used, the grain may appear dull and the wood will be more susceptible to damage.

2. Protection
The primary function of finishing oil is to safeguard wood surfaces against environmental factors and daily wear. This protection manifests in several key areas: moisture resistance, scratch resistance, and UV protection. Finishing oil permeates the wood, creating a barrier that mitigates the absorption of water, preventing swelling, warping, and rot. This is particularly crucial for wood items exposed to humidity or direct contact with liquids. For instance, a table treated with finishing oil resists water rings and stains more effectively than an untreated surface. Additionally, the hardened oil provides a degree of scratch resistance, shielding the wood from minor abrasions. While not impenetrable, the oil significantly reduces the likelihood of surface damage from everyday use. Furthermore, some formulations contain UV inhibitors, which slow the fading and discoloration of wood exposed to sunlight. The protective attributes of finishing oil directly contribute to the longevity and aesthetic appeal of treated wood surfaces.
The level of protection afforded by the oil depends on several factors including the type of wood, the number of coats applied, and the specific formulation of the oil. Denser hardwoods generally require fewer coats than softwoods to achieve adequate protection. Applying multiple thin coats, rather than a single thick coat, allows for better penetration and a more robust protective layer. Additionally, some specialized oil formulations are designed for specific environments or applications, offering enhanced resistance to moisture, heat, or chemicals. For example, oil intended for outdoor furniture may contain higher concentrations of UV inhibitors and water repellents compared to oil designed for interior use.

6. Maintenance
The sustained efficacy of wood finishing oil is inextricably linked to consistent maintenance practices. This involves routine cleaning and periodic reapplication to preserve the finish’s integrity and protective qualities. The absence of appropriate maintenance can lead to the degradation of the finish, rendering the wood susceptible to moisture damage, scratches, and fading. For instance, neglecting to regularly clean a wooden tabletop finished with this oil will allow the accumulation of dust and grime, which can dull the surface and compromise its water resistance. In turn, the wood becomes more vulnerable to staining and warping. This illustrates the direct cause-and-effect relationship between maintenance and the longevity of the protective layer.
Maintenance is a critical component of this specific product’s overall performance. Reapplication is essential for replenishing the oil that is gradually lost due to wear or exposure to environmental elements. Consider a wooden floor treated with this finish. Regular sweeping and occasional damp mopping with a pH-neutral cleaner are necessary to remove dirt and debris. However, after several months, depending on foot traffic, the protective layer begins to thin, necessitating the application of a maintenance coat of finishing oil. This revitalizes the finish, restores its sheen, and reinforces its protective barrier. The frequency of reapplication varies depending on the severity of use and environmental conditions, but it is an indispensable aspect of maintaining the wood’s optimal condition.

7. Composition
The composition of wood finishing oil dictates its performance characteristics, influencing drying time, penetration, durability, and overall aesthetic outcome. The specific blend of oils, resins, and additives determines how the product interacts with the wood substrate and the level of protection it affords. For instance, a formulation with a high concentration of drying oils, such as linseed or tung oil, will typically exhibit a longer drying time but may offer superior penetration and a more durable finish. Conversely, the inclusion of solvents can accelerate drying but may compromise the oil’s long-term protective qualities.
The practical significance of understanding this product’s composition lies in the ability to select the appropriate formulation for a specific application. Oils containing UV inhibitors are essential for protecting wood surfaces exposed to sunlight, while those with added fungicides are beneficial for use in humid environments. The absence of volatile organic compounds (VOCs) in certain formulations is also a crucial consideration for environmental and health reasons. The impact of its components is exemplified in the treatment of antique furniture, where conservation-grade oil, often composed of natural ingredients like beeswax and carnauba wax, is preferred for its gentle action and reversible properties. Choosing the incorrect blend can potentially damage valuable artifacts.

Frequently Asked Questions
The following questions address common inquiries regarding the application, performance, and safety aspects of wood finishing oil.
Question 1: What is the expected drying time for wood finishing oil?
Drying time varies significantly based on ambient temperature, humidity, and the specific composition of the oil. Generally, allow for a minimum of 24 hours between coats, and up to 72 hours for full curing. Refer to the manufacturer’s instructions for precise drying times.
Question 2: How many coats of wood finishing oil are recommended?
Typically, two to three coats are sufficient for most applications. The first coat penetrates the wood, providing a foundation for subsequent coats. Additional coats enhance protection and visual appeal. Avoid applying excessive amounts of oil, as this can lead to a tacky or uneven finish.
Question 3: Can wood finishing oil be applied over existing finishes?
Generally, it is not advisable to apply this over existing finishes. Prior coatings may impede penetration and adhesion. For best results, remove any existing finishes through sanding or chemical stripping before applying the oil.
Question 4: Is wood finishing oil suitable for outdoor use?
Some formulations are designed for outdoor applications and contain UV inhibitors and water repellents. Always select a product specifically labeled for exterior use. Note that even with specialized outdoor oil, periodic reapplication is necessary to maintain protection against the elements.
Question 5: How should brushes and cloths used for applying wood finishing oil be cleaned or disposed of?
Brushes can be cleaned with mineral spirits or turpentine, following the manufacturer’s instructions. Rags saturated with oil are a fire hazard and should be laid flat to dry in a well-ventilated area away from combustible materials or disposed of in a metal container filled with water.
Question 6: Is wood finishing oil food-safe?
While some natural oil finishes are considered food-safe once fully cured, it is essential to verify the specific product’s suitability for contact with food. Look for certifications or labeling indicating compliance with food safety standards, particularly if using on cutting boards or other food preparation surfaces.
